The symbolism behind rose tattoo colors. Red roses often stand for love and romance, but can also be used as a memorial or to commemorate a sacrifice of some kind, perhaps honoring a loved one in the military or law enforcement who was killed in the line of duty. Strength and Resilience: Roses have thorns, which can represent strength and resilience. A rose tattoo can serve as a reminder of overcoming challenges, difficulties, or a symbol of inner strength.
